      Server Description

      A bare-metal ARM server delivering high-bandwidth networking and strong multi-core performance for compute-intensive and network-bound workloads.

      Compute OptimizedGeneral Purpose

      Amazon Web Services c7gn.metal is a bare-metal, compute-optimized server featuring 64 dedicated physical cores on the 64-bit ARMv8 architecture, powered by AWS Graviton Neoverse-V1 processors running at 2.6 GHz. Equipped with 128.0 GB of DDR5 memory, the server provides a balanced 2.0 GB of RAM per core. It lacks local storage and discrete GPUs, relying instead on a high-capacity 200 Gbps baseline network bandwidth for external data transfer and EBS connectivity. Benchmark data highlights top-tier multi-core performance, particularly in software compilation and memory bandwidth tests, alongside strong database and static web serving capabilities. This configuration makes the c7gn.metal highly efficient for multi-threaded, network-intensive workloads, including large-scale web serving, software build pipelines, and distributed database operations.

      Workload Profiles

      3.43Score
      Precomputed compound score for Cache Intensive workloads. A weighted average (geometric mean) of benchmark scores compared to their medians: score = ∏ (x_i / m_i)^(w_i / Σw). The score of 1.0 represents a synthetic baseline server with the median performance of each component benchmark; 0.5 means roughly half the performance; and 2.0 means twice the performance of that reference profile. Component weights: 50% Redis RPS (pipeline=1, SET), 20% Redis RPS (pipeline=16, SET), 10% PassMark Memory Mark (composite), 10% Memory bandwidth (read, 16 MB ~ L3), 10% PassMark single-thread CPU. Rationale for component selection: In-memory key-value store workload, mixing direct Redis performance metrics with memory speed and latency benchmarks, and single-core CPU performance profiles.
